THE BEATLES Help! (1965 UK first press 14-track Mono LP on the black & yellow Parlophone label, with 'Sold in The U.K.' and 'The Gramophone Co.' label text. This label variant has all the tracklisting in smaller bold text with 'Northern Songs, NCB' text above the artist name, front laminated round ended flipback picture sleeve with small outline 'mono' on the front and 'Patents Pending' on the bottom flipback PMC1255)
See 'Additional Info' for further details on the condition..
#Top 500 Greatest Albums Of All Time.

Tracklisting: The labels are matt finish with Parlophone logo in bold yellow. The perimeter print has 'The Gramophone Co' text with 'Sold In The UK' text across the centre of the label. The matrix numbers are XEX 549-2 & XEX 550-2 The Garrod & Lofthouse sleeve has the small outline mono logo on the front and 'Patents Pending' credit on the back bottom flipback. Complete with correct period 'Emitex' inner. Condition: This is a one owner copy. The sleeve shows minimal signs of being over fifty plus years old. There are only a few very minor creases to the front of the sleeve, and minor shelfwear, there is a small bloacked out line on the reverse [like from the previous owner's annoated name or initials] but the flipbacks and back panels are clean, bright and undamaged, the spine print is clear and legible, with little discoloration. The labels are clean and bright with only light signs of spindle hole to show minimal play. The heavyweight vinyl has retained its bright shine as only well looked after vinyl can. The vinyl itself remains in EX condition with only a few very light cosmetic surface scuffs or hairlines visible upon inspection which have no effect on play. A very nice example of this classic Fabs LP. Tracklisting: 01. Help! 02. The Night Before 03. You've Got To Hide Your Love Away 04. I Need You 05. Another Girl 06. You're Going To Lose That Girl 07.
